Rockets Improve With Moves; On Paper at Least

2007/08/11 17:26:56 @NBA.com: News

Marty Burns of the Sports Illustrated writes, "New Rockets general manager Daryl Morey has been aggressive in his first offseason at the Houston helm, adding veteran guards Steve Francis and Mike James as well as Argentine power forward Luis Scola. Along with new coach Rick Adelman and the return of Bonzi Wells, the Rockets suddenly look like a more potent and deeper team -- at least on paper. 'We definitely felt there was a talent gap between us and [the top] teams, and we wanted to close it,' Morey said. 'We still have to go out and prove it. But we feel we're at least in the mix now with San Antonio, Dallas and the other top teams.'"
